What Testing Actually Reveals
Understanding the quality of your water in Indian Shores, FL, begins with proper testing. Basic tests can reveal issues such as hardness, pH levels, and the presence of contaminants. Hard water, indicated by high calcium and magnesium levels, can lead to scaling in pipes and appliances. A simple hardness test measures these minerals and can help determine if a water softener is necessary for your home.
In addition to measuring hardness, testing for pH is essential. Water that is too acidic or alkaline can cause corrosion in pipes or affect the taste of your drinking water. A pH test will guide homeowners on whether adjustments are needed to ensure the water is neutral, which is ideal for both plumbing and health. Furthermore, testing for microbial contaminants is crucial, especially in areas close to the coast. Water samples should be checked for bacteria and other organic matter that may pose health risks. If detected, further treatment may be warranted.
Once you have completed initial testing, it’s wise to retest regularly. Changes in seasonal weather, increased rainfall, or nearby construction can impact water quality. To stay proactive, consider conducting tests every six months or sooner if any noticeable changes occur in water taste, appearance, or odor. Keeping an eye on these factors will ensure your water remains safe and pleasant for family use.
Well Versus Municipal Supply: Understanding Your Water Source
In Indian Shores, FL, the decision between using well water and municipal supply significantly influences how homeowners approach water treatment. Those relying on well water typically face unique challenges, including higher mineral content and potential contaminants from natural sources. This often necessitates more robust treatment options to ensure the water is safe and palatable for everyday use.
On the other hand, municipal water, while generally treated to meet safety standards, can still be affected by factors such as aging infrastructure and issues like saltwater intrusion. Homeowners on city supply may experience chlorine taste or fluctuating water quality, which could prompt a need for additional filtration solutions. Understanding these differences is essential in determining which treatment system is appropriate for your needs.
